Here are few steps
that we can
take to
reduce the total amount of wastage in Hong Kong.
Use less plastic
bags- The
government’s
initiation on levying fifty cents per extra plastic bags on all the
major
stores throughout Hong Kong is in fact a plausible act, however, there
are
still so many of the vendors/shops and stores around the streets of
Hong Kong
that until we can bring them all on the board, the usage of the plastic
bags
will be still in a very big volume. That should be the ultimate goal
otherwise
all the good starts will be just in vain.
Start recycling our
wastage-
Most of the
housing estates in Hong Kong already have separated recycling bins for
such as
plastic, aluminum, papers/cardboards etc. They are also advised to
separate the
recyclable wastage from the non-recyclable one. Notices and information
on
different languages are also provided. The young generations are quite
well aware
of the trends and are much conscious nevertheless, the main problem
seems to be
to the old generations, as the saying goes, good old habits never die,
as we
still think that going through with your wastage is really the waste of
time.

Whenever there is a new owner in any apartments in Hong Kong, we have a
tendency of tearing it apart from inside out and put completely a new
decoration, I have seen myself in one of the particular apartment in
our floor
has been decorated for at least three times by the new owner, you might
argue
that it is my property so I will do as I want, however, I saw two major
drawback on doing just that. One, it is extremely noisy and disturbing
to the
neighbors, second, the wastage it will create would have been
definitely much
bigger than the floor’s wastage for whole month and not to mentioned
that it is
also very expensive. Therefore, sometime, I wonder why we can not just
keep the
same decoration as it already has, what is wrong with that? This way,
at least
we can save ours neighbors from the hell and also save a lot of money
at the
same time for rainy days. I did that when I got my apartment and will
also do
the same in the future.
